
Tampa, FL – MIRA USA joined the National Summit for the Rights of Immigrants “One Voice: Unity on Capitol Hill,” in Washington, DC, from September 27-28, 2017. Leaders from more than 200 Hispanic Organizations working for the communities in the United States gathered to make our voices heard on Capitol Hill.

MIRA USA was invited by the Hispanic Federation to the Welcome Reception, which was attended by some Congressmen, and in which we had the opportunity to share and exchange information with the other Leaders on the most relevant issues that our immigrant community is currently facing.
On September 28, along with other leaders of the State of Florid. MIRA USA visited the Office of Darren Soto, Representative of the 9th District of Florida, who heard the problems faced by immigrants such as education, lack of employment, lack of documents, support for the victims of the most recent natural disasters (Puerto Rico and Mexico), among other topics. Our message as an organization for the rights of immigrants was to provide an opportunity to obtain documents through studies such as those in Canada or Australia, to support the DREAM Act, and other measures to solve the situation faced by thousands of immigrants in the country.
We then visited the office of Representative Kathy Castor of 14th District of Florida, who was not in the office, Lara Hopkins, Deputy Chief of Staff assisted instead.
Hopkins said that representative Castor also supports the DREAM Act, does not agree with the construction of the wall in Mexico and that they are working to provide more aid to the state of Florida after the passage of Hurricane Irma.
Our organization was proud to have had the opportunity to be the voice of the immigrant community at this annual summit, knowing firsthand the daily needs that afflict us, and longing for Congressmen to vote in favor of public policies that benefit our communities.
